How they compare

Republic of Korea currently reports 1,571 m3 against 1,066 m3 in Cayman Islands, a difference of 505 m3.

That makes Republic of Korea's figure about 1.5 times Cayman Islands's.

The two have swapped places 3 times across 14 shared years of data; in 2009 it was Cayman Islands ahead.

Cayman Islands ranks 54th and Republic of Korea ranks 51st of 173 countries.

Across the 3 decades both report, Cayman Islands averaged higher in 2 and Republic of Korea in 1.

The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
